第6部分學(xué)習(xí)指南技術(shù)at89c51說明書_第1頁
第6部分學(xué)習(xí)指南技術(shù)at89c51說明書_第2頁
第6部分學(xué)習(xí)指南技術(shù)at89c51說明書_第3頁
第6部分學(xué)習(xí)指南技術(shù)at89c51說明書_第4頁
第6部分學(xué)習(xí)指南技術(shù)at89c51說明書_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

圖2- 2-1AT89C51AT89C51的復(fù)位信號輸入引腳,高電位工作,當(dāng)要對又時,只要將此引腳電位提升到高電位,并持續(xù)兩個機器周期以上的時間,AT89C51便能完成系統(tǒng)復(fù)位的各項工作,ALE是英文 地址總線(A0-A7)鎖存進(jìn)入鎖存器中。在非外部間,ALE引腳的輸出頻率是系統(tǒng)工作頻率的1/16,因此可以用來驅(qū)動其他的時鐘輸入。當(dāng)問外部間,將以1/12振蕩頻率輸出。該引腳為低電平時,則外部的程序代碼(存于外部EPROM中)來執(zhí)行程序。因此在8031中,EA引腳必須接低電位,因為其內(nèi)部無程序器空間。如果是使用AT89C51此為"ProgramStoreEnable"的縮寫。外部程序器選通信號,低電平有效。在訪器指令時,不產(chǎn)生PSEN信號,在外部數(shù)據(jù)時,亦不產(chǎn)生PSEN信號。P0口(P0.0~P0.7)是一個8位漏極開路雙向輸入輸出端口,當(dāng)外部數(shù)據(jù)時,它是地址總每一個引腳可以推動8個LSTTL負(fù)載。P2口(P2.0~P2.7)口是具有內(nèi)部提升電路的雙向I/0端口(準(zhǔn)雙向并行I/O口),當(dāng)外每一個引腳可以推動4個LSTL負(fù)載。P1口(P1.0~P1.7)I/0端口(I/O口),其輸出可以推動4個LSTTL負(fù)載。用戶作為輸入輸出用的端口。P3口(P3.0~P3.7)I/0端口(I/O口),它還提供 INT0外部中斷0輸入,低電平有效 INT1外部中斷1輸入,低電平有效 T0計數(shù)器0外部計數(shù)輸入端 T1計數(shù)器1外部計數(shù)輸入端 RD外部隨 外部程序外部程序內(nèi)部程序外部程序

圖2-2只讀程序 圖2-3外部數(shù)據(jù)F

B 符

P——AB0(NT((NT(E(NT(E2-8各中斷源向量地址—P (PSW.4):寄存器組選擇位1。RS0(PSW.3)0。OV(PSW.2):溢出標(biāo)志位。 位個數(shù)是奇數(shù)個則P=1,偶數(shù)個則P=0。000011102113IE——EA(IE.7):EA=0時,所有中斷停用(中斷 ET2(IE.5)2溢出的中斷(8052使用(IE.4):允許串行端口的中斷(ES=1允許,ES=0。ET1(IE.3):允許計時器1中斷(ET1=1允許,ET1=0。EX1(IE.2):允許外部中斷INT1的中斷(EX1=1允許,EX1=0。ET0(IE.1):允許計時器0中斷(ET0=1允許,ET0=0。EX0———— PT2(IP.5)2的優(yōu)先次序(8052使用 (IP.3)1(IP.2)INT1(IP.1):設(shè)定計時器0的優(yōu)先次序。PX0(IP.0):設(shè)定外部中斷INT0的優(yōu)先次序。12345不可位尋GATEGATE=1時,INT0INT1TCONTR0C/T:選擇定時或計數(shù)器模式。當(dāng)C/T=1為計數(shù)器,由外部引腳T0T1輸入計數(shù)脈沖。C/T=0時為計時器,由內(nèi)部系統(tǒng)時鐘提供計時工作脈沖。 功能說001101018108TF1(TCON.7)11,在執(zhí)行相對的中斷服務(wù)程序后則自動清0。TR1(TCON.6)1啟動控制位,可以由軟件來設(shè)定或清除。TR1時啟動計時器工作,TRl=0時關(guān)閉。TF0(TCON.5)01,在執(zhí)行相對的中斷服務(wù)程序后則自動清0。TR0(TCON.4)0啟動控制位,可以由軟件來設(shè)定或清除。TR0=1時,IE1(TCON.3)1工作標(biāo)志,當(dāng)外部中斷被檢查出來時,硬件自動設(shè)定此位,在執(zhí)行中斷服務(wù)程序后,則清0。IT1(TCON.2):外部中斷1工作形式選擇,IT1=1IT1=0IE0(TCON.1)0工作標(biāo)志,當(dāng)外部中斷被檢查出來時,硬件自動設(shè)定此位,在執(zhí)行中斷服務(wù)程序后,則清0。IT0(TCON.0)0工作形式選擇,IT1=1SM0(SCON.7)0。SM1(SCON.6):串行通訊工作方式設(shè)定位1。SM2(SCON.5)2323時,如SM2=1,REN=1RB8=1(地址幀)才激發(fā)中斷請RB8=0的數(shù)據(jù)幀;1SM2=l,則只有在接收到有效停止位時才置位中斷請求標(biāo)志位RI=1;在方式0時,SM2應(yīng)為0。REN(SCON.4):REN,允許/串行接收控制位。由軟件置位REN=1為允許串行0,則RB8是接收到的停止位。方式0不用RB8。TI(SCON.1):發(fā)送中斷請求標(biāo)志位。在方式08位結(jié)束時,TI=l,向主機請求中斷,響應(yīng)中斷后必須用軟件復(fù)外情況見SM2說明),必須由軟件復(fù)位RI=0。0001101/641/3211不可位尋——— 其中TC為初值,M為計數(shù)器模值,T定時器定時時間,T計數(shù)MT 0:波特率

2:波特率

(M-TC為次/秒。那么串行通訊方式1、3的波特率可寫為:波特率

2SMOD

fosc

M注:SMODPCONSMOD位的設(shè)置,SMOD=10.××××××

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論